Course Content

• Advanced Statistical Methods for Marine Data Analysis
• Feature Engineering Techniques for Biodiversity Datasets
• Machine Learning for Marine Biodiversity Prediction
• Remote Sensing and GIS for Marine Habitat Mapping (includes keyword: GIS)
• Marine Biodiversity Informatics and Data Management
• Spatial and Temporal Analysis of Marine Ecosystems
• Deep Learning for Marine Image and Acoustic Data Analysis (includes keywords: Deep Learning, Image Analysis)
• Conservation Planning and Decision Support Systems using Feature Engineering
• Ethical Considerations in Marine Data Science
• Communicating Marine Biodiversity Research using Data Visualization

Career path

Career Role (Marine Biodiversity Feature Engineering) Description
Marine Data Scientist Develops and implements advanced feature engineering techniques for analyzing large marine biodiversity datasets. High demand for expertise in statistical modeling and machine learning.
Marine Bioinformatician Specializes in the computational analysis of marine genomic and environmental data, applying feature engineering for improved biodiversity insights. Strong programming and bioinformatics skills essential.
Oceanographic Data Analyst Focuses on feature engineering for oceanographic data, extracting meaningful patterns for understanding marine ecosystems and biodiversity. Requires expertise in data visualization and interpretation.
Environmental Consultant (Marine Focus) Applies feature engineering skills to assess environmental impacts and inform conservation strategies for marine biodiversity. Strong understanding of ecological principles and regulatory frameworks.
